Over 900 million people now use ChatGPT weekly. Gemini crossed 750 million monthly users. And 58.5% of U.S. searches end with zero clicks.

The question is no longer whether AI search matters. The question is whether you know what these engines say about your brand.

AI visibility tracking shows whether ChatGPT, Perplexity, Claude, Gemini, Google AI Overviews, and other answer engines cite your brand when buyers ask real questions. Traditional rank tracking shows where you sit on a page. AI visibility tracking shows whether the machine repeats your name at all.

What to measure

AI visibility is not one metric. It is a system of signals. Track these first:

  • Mention rate: How often AI engines name your brand
  • Citation count: How often your pages are cited
  • Share of voice: How often you appear compared with competitors
  • Position: Where your brand appears in the answer
  • Sentiment: How the engine frames your brand
  • Engine coverage: Which AI engines include or skip you
  • Citation velocity: Whether citations are rising or falling over time

Do not stop at visibility. The real question is what changed and what you should publish next.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is AI visibility?

AI visibility measures whether AI engines mention or cite your brand when users ask relevant questions. Traditional SEO tracks where you rank on a results page. AI visibility tracks whether you appear in the answer itself.

Why does AI visibility matter?

Buyers now ask ChatGPT, Perplexity, Claude, Gemini, and Google AI Overviews before they click a website. If your brand is missing from those answers, you lose consideration before the buyer reaches your site.

Which AI engines matter most?

At minimum, track ChatGPT, Perplexity, Claude, Gemini, and Google AI Overviews. Reddit also matters because AI engines often cite Reddit discussions when answering buyer questions.

How can teams improve citations?

The strongest content is specific, sourced, and easy for AI engines to extract. Add clear claims, expert quotes, statistics, comparison context, and citations. Write like a source, not like a landing page.
